Understanding the Foundations of Secure Coding
The Professional Certificate in Secure Coding Essentials for Developers starts by laying the groundwork for secure coding practices. This foundation is built on understanding the principles of secure coding, including data validation, error handling, and secure coding standards. Developers learn how to identify potential vulnerabilities and implement countermeasures to prevent attacks. For instance, a case study on a popular e-commerce platform revealed that a simple input validation flaw allowed hackers to inject malicious code, resulting in a massive data breach. By applying secure coding principles, developers can prevent such vulnerabilities and ensure the integrity of their applications.
Real-World Applications and Case Studies
One of the key strengths of the Professional Certificate in Secure Coding Essentials for Developers is its focus on practical, real-world applications. Students learn through hands-on exercises and case studies, analyzing the security flaws and vulnerabilities of real-world applications. For example, a study on the OpenSSL Heartbleed bug revealed how a simple coding mistake led to a catastrophic vulnerability, compromising the security of millions of users. By examining such cases, developers gain a deeper understanding of the consequences of insecure coding practices and learn how to apply secure coding principles to prevent similar vulnerabilities in their own applications.
Industry-Relevant Tools and Technologies
The Professional Certificate in Secure Coding Essentials for Developers also covers industry-relevant tools and technologies, including static analysis tools, fuzz testing, and secure coding frameworks. Students learn how to integrate these tools into their development workflows, ensuring that their applications are secure and reliable. A case study on a leading financial institution, for instance, demonstrated how the use of static analysis tools helped identify and fix security vulnerabilities in their mobile banking app, resulting in a significant reduction in security incidents.
